Hyaluronic Acid (HA): The Fountain Of Youth Molecule

HA is a naturally-occurring, water-loving, water-binding element. The presence of HA, and the ability to create our skin's own HA, is depleted over time with age and skin damage. When we have more HA, fine lines are smoothed, dryness is relieved, and loss of moisture is prevented. The right HA is not only essential to your skin looking fabulous, it's also essential to long-term skin health.

Imagine there's a sponge underneath the top layer of your skin. Imagine that it shrinks as we get older, reducing our ability to hold water in the skin. No matter what moisturizer you use, the amount of water your skin can hold on to is not what it was. We need to restore and replenish that sponge, it's been getting dry and crispy over time.

What is infrared?

IR makes up more than half of the solar spectrum. IR penetrates deeper into the skin than UV rays. -This is a scary thought, because  well, deeper in the skin means more damage to the skin. img_3319

"Infrared radiation lies between the visible and microwave portions of the electromagnetic spectrum. Infrared waves have wavelengths longer than (the) visible ... the primary source of infrared radiation is heat or thermal radiation... The higher the temperature, the more the atoms and molecules move and the more infrared radiation they produce."

...According to California Institute of Technology's CoolCosmos.com Read the whole article here 

IR manifests itself as heat on the skin, so when you're outside and you're feeling the heat, IR is doing it's evil work on your subcutaneous layers.

Advanced Glycation End-products (AGEs)
AGE is a a conveniently-coincidental acronym for Advanced Glycation End-products, which are the evil little products of a reaction between glucose (sugar) and proteins... Specifically collagen and elastin in this case (glycation).
Yes, it tastes good, but excess sugar in your diet screws up more than just your waistline.
How does it cause aging? 
Glucose is good, of course, in the way of providing energy. But when there's extra glucose, it rumbles with our collagen and elastin. This process produces AGEs, which make these fibers crispy and easily breakable. This reaction contributes to inflammation, slowed/inhibited growth of cells, and wrinkles (oh my!).
To simplify, think of it as turning your normal, elastic rubber band-like fibers into an old, dried out and crumbly rubber band. When AGE's wreak havoc, your rubber bands are in an accelerated aging state, causing that loss of elasticity, sagging, and wrinkles.
You know all those old, crumbly rubber bands in the back of your desk drawer? That's your elastin after AGE's.
In an article for Prevention, dermatologist Dr Frederic Brandt (well-known for his research in AGE's) breaks it down further: "Besides damaging collagen, a high-sugar diet also affects what type of collagen you have—another factor in how resistant skin is to wrinkling... The most abundant collagens in the skin are types I, II, and III, with type III being the most stable and longest lasting. Glycation transforms type III collagen into type I, which is more fragile.
The article goes on to describe that "AGEs deactivate your body's natural antioxidant enzymes, leaving you more vulnerable to sun damage—still the main cause of skin aging."

Matrix Metalloproteinases (MMPs) are enzymes -envision Pac-Man!- activated by inflammation.  Inflammation can be caused by elements like UV exposure and infrared radiation. MMPs are not cool because they contribute to the breakdown of collagen. And as if that wasn't bad enough... they also work to inhibit new collagen formation.

For a scholarly article type of resource, check out this white paper on The National Center for Biotechnology Information website. They say Matrix-degrading metalloproteinases are key mediators of collagen degradation that is observed in photoaged skin. Key mediators? Oh man!! Screen Shot 2015-08-17 at 6.51.42 PM

The Production of Evil Villain #1: ROS, aka Reactive Oxygen Species

Free radicals: A bull in the china shop (of your skin) at theproductpro.wordpress.com

ROS: These little oxidative destructors are also known as free radicals. When they're produced by damage, they are missing an electron - so they'll tazmanian-devil through otherwise stable molecules wreaking all kinds of havoc.

Throughout this mission of destruction, they are looking to steal an electron for themselves, causing those other normal cells to become free-radicals, too. This chain reaction of destruction and theft leads to inflammation, damage, and the cross-linking of collagen and elastin (wrinkles!!)

Eeek! What should I do, you ask? The best product-related helpers are antioxidants and sunscreens, which both help prevent the formation in the first place, and help neutralize the offenders. Vitamin C: it's not just for breakfast... Products that Prevent

The best product-related helpers to prevent damage to the skin are arguably antioxidants and sunscreens, which both help prevent the formation of free radicals in the first place, and also help neutralize these offenders.

Picture a knight in shining armor, swinging a sword at an evil free radical, he'd be considered the antioxidant.

How can we ever thank you, Antioxidant?! At theProductPro.wordpress.com


My go-to, long-standing favorite antioxidants are topical Vitamin C's.

 Topical vitamin C's are known to have many benefits, including:

  •  Neutralizing free radicals, preventing skin aging
  •  Helping to maintain normal cellular turnover
  •  Helping to build collagen
  •  Lightening and brightening the skin
  •  Reducing inflammation
  •  Decreasing transepidermal water loss (your skin won't leak moisture so much)

The Need-To-Know:

How to Use Vitamin C: Use Vitamin C in the mornings after toner and before moisturizers and sunscreens to help defend skin from the onslaught of pollutants, sun, and all kinds of other threats that you'll meet out there during your busy day.

Think: I'm drinking my OJ in the morning, My skin needs its Vitamin C in the morning, too!

Mom always said: Drink Your OJ! ... but dont forget your morning topical C! at TheProductPro.wordpress.comOh, and don't forget the neck, chest, and the backs of the hands... they need protection, too.

Buyer Beware: Even though Vitamin C is a sort of 'knight in shining armor', it's also really unstable... always about to oxidize and die. Be sure that you don't go with just ANY vitamin C. Those that have published research or from reputable companies are the best bet.

Oxidation: If you've got a water-based C (L-ascorbic) like CE Ferulic, for example, be sure you toss it when it starts to turn orange/amber in color.  This assures that your product isn't weakened or *GASP* causing oxidation. This is an ANTI-OXIDANT, for goodness sake.

Acne Patients Beware: Vitamin C's are great for many people, but acne patients should avoid: even though Vitamin C's are great to lighten acne marks from old breakouts, they are not the best choice for those currently breaking out. If you currently have active acne, get your breakouts under control first, and then consider choosing a formula meant for all or oily skin types.

Antioxidants both ways:

The antioxidants found in Essential Serum include ergothionine, green tea extract, blackberry leaf extract, saccharomyces ferment filtrate, coenzyme Q-10, tocopheryl acetate (E) and tetrahexyldecyl ascorbate (lipid-soluble C), which are all free-radical fighters.

Just like SkinMedica's C & E Complex, there's a combo of water- and lipid-soluble antioxidants here.  This is good because the water-soluble antioxidants can weave down between skin cells. The lipid-soluble's are meant to actually enter the cell through its membrane. The two types of action here means that you're covering your bases and in for a better result.
